I check the video I don't understand here is why do I need to top up my credit ? Does sound like a payment?
Every new drivers would have a preloaded RM15 wallet (called Credit Balance). This starting amount is subject to change.
This section is where Grab will auto-deduct commission whenever you accept a job.
Let's say you receive a RM4 job. Grab will deduct RM1 (25% from the RM4) from this Credit Balance.
You will take the RM4 for your own use. That's yours completely.
NOTE: new Grab drivers subjected to 25% commission. older drivers get 20% (eg. Grab take 80cent from RM4 job).
If the Credit Balance drops below RM15, you won't get any jobs. You can buy a top-up via E-pay (buy from Petronas station, ask for Grab top-up). Generally, new drivers will buy top-up first before starting their drive.
I bought a RM20 using my own money. Then, after completing several jobs, you can use your earned income to buy more top-ups if required.
